It might seem like a tactic for people who just want to cling to their 20s for as long as possible, but it actually has a practical use: Your birth date, year included, is a key piece of information to steal your identity. 2. chuck a rama breakfastWebIdentity theft is a type of fraud. It involves using someone else’s identity to steal their personal information, money or other benefits. Someone committing identity theft might use someone else’s personal details to: access existing bank accounts or credit cards. open new bank accounts and take out lines of credit. designers touch floristWebSeven Signs of Identity Theft. Identity theft occurs when personal information such as your name, address, date of birth or contact details are stolen or accessed. It can often lead to identity fraud – when the stolen information is used in fraudulent activity to gain certain goods or services.
